33 | V62C1162048L | Ultra Low Power 128K x 16 CMOS SRAM V62C1162048L(L)
Ultra Low Power 128K x 16 CMOS SRAM
Features
• Low-power consumption - Active: 35mA ICC at 70ns - Stand-by: 10 µA (CMOS input/output) 2 µA (CMOS input/output, L version) • 70/85/100/120 ns access time • Equal access and cycle time • Single +1.8V to2.2V Power Supply • Tri |
